Instance Property

shouldGroupAccessibilityChildren

A Boolean value indicating whether VoiceOver should group together the elements that are children of the receiver, regardless of their positions on the screen.

Declaration

@property(nonatomic) BOOL shouldGroupAccessibilityChildren;

Discussion

The default value for this property is NO.

For example, consider an app that shows items in vertical columns. Normally, VoiceOver would navigate through these items in horizontal rows. Setting the value of this property to YES on the parent view of the items in the vertical columns causes VoiceOver to respect the app’s grouping and navigate them correctly.

See Also

Configuring Behavior

Accessibility Traits

Tell an assistive application how an accessibility element behaves or should be treated by setting these accessibility traits

accessibilityTraits

The combination of accessibility traits that best characterize the accessibility element.

UIAccessibilityTraits

A mask that contains the OR combination of the accessibility traits that best characterize an accessibility element.

accessibilityCustomRotors

An array of custom rotors for the current element.

accessibilityElementsHidden

A Boolean value indicating whether the accessibility elements contained within this accessibility element are hidden.

accessibilityNotifiesWhenDestroyed

A Boolean value that indicates whether a custom accessibility object sends a notification when its corresponding UI element is destroyed.

accessibilityRespondsToUserInteraction

A Boolean value indicating whether the element performs an action based on user interaction.

accessibilityViewIsModal

A Boolean value indicating whether VoiceOver should ignore the elements within views that are siblings of the receiver.